Glen Rock Athletic Club
221 Main St, Glen Rock
(201) 652-9807
Recent Reviews
I stopped by the club the other day to pick up my membership card and had a quick beer. Wish I could have stayed longer but I had BBQ going in the smoker. Anyhow, as a newcomer, I have to say the guys I met were great, welcomed me as if I had been a member there for years. It's a great place to relax and shoot the breeze with some good guys.